Understanding Orlando's Flooring Landscape
Orlando homeowners have a wide range of flooring options available, each suited to different needs and lifestyles. The region's warm climate and occasional humidity spikes make certain materials more practical than others. Tile remains one of the most popular choices for Florida homes because it handles moisture exceptionally well and stays cool underfoot during hot months.
Hardwood floors continue to be a favorite among Orlando residents, though not all wood types perform equally in this climate. Engineered hardwood often proves more stable than solid hardwood when dealing with humidity fluctuations throughout the year. Many homeowners appreciate the warmth and character that real wood brings to living spaces, especially in bedrooms and formal areas where moisture exposure is minimal.
Luxury vinyl plank flooring has gained significant traction in recent years as a practical alternative for high-traffic areas. These products resist scratches, handle water exposure well, and come in designs that convincingly mimic natural materials at a fraction of the cost. Kitchens, bathrooms, and entryways particularly benefit from this durability.
Carpet remains relevant in Orlando homes, especially in bedrooms and spaces where comfort matters most. Modern carpet options include stain-resistant treatments and moisture-blocking underlayments that address traditional concerns about humidity damage.
Coordinating Decor With Your Floor Choices
Once you have selected your flooring, the next step involves choosing decorative elements that complement rather than compete with your floor's characteristics. The color palette of your floors influences everything from paint selection to furniture fabrics and accessory choices.
For warm-toned wood floors or terracotta-colored tile, consider incorporating earth tones, soft greens, and muted blues in your decor scheme. These colors create a cohesive look that feels intentional rather than random. Cooler flooring options like gray slate or white marble pair beautifully with bold accent colors and contemporary furniture pieces.
Textural contrast adds visual interest to any room. Smooth tile floors benefit from plush rugs and woven textiles, while hardwood surfaces work well with sleek leather furniture and metallic accents. The key is creating balance so that your decorative elements enhance the flooring rather than overwhelming it.
Lighting plays a crucial role in how your floors and decor appear throughout the day. Orlando homes often feature abundant natural light, which can dramatically shift the appearance of both flooring materials and decorative pieces as the sun moves across the sky. Strategic placement of mirrors and thoughtful window treatments help manage this effect.
Budget-Friendly Strategies for Floor Upgrades
Transforming your floors does not require a complete overhaul or a major budget commitment. Many homeowners discover that strategic updates produce impressive results without breaking the bank.
Refinishing existing hardwood floors represents one of the most cost-effective upgrades available. A professional sanding and refinishing can breathe new life into older floors for a fraction of replacement costs. This approach works particularly well in Orlando homes where original wood floors may have accumulated years of wear but remain structurally sound.
For tile floors, regrouting rather than full replacement often addresses the most common issues. Discolored or cracked grout lines can make otherwise beautiful tile look dated and worn. A thorough cleaning and fresh grout application can dramatically improve the appearance of any tiled area.
Area rugs offer another budget-conscious approach to enhancing floor aesthetics. High-quality rugs in complementary colors and patterns can elevate a room's overall look while providing additional comfort underfoot. Many Orlando homeowners use seasonal rug changes to refresh their spaces without permanent commitments.

Frequently Asked Questions
What type of flooring works best for Orlando's humid climate?
Tile and luxury vinyl plank flooring perform exceptionally well in Orlando's humidity. Both materials resist moisture damage and maintain their appearance through seasonal changes. Engineered hardwood also proves a solid choice when properly sealed and maintained.
How often should I replace or refinish my floors?
Hardwood floors typically last 20 to 30 years before requiring refinishing, though this depends on traffic levels and maintenance routines. Tile flooring can last decades with minimal upkeep. Luxury vinyl plank usually lasts 15 to 20 years before replacement becomes necessary.
Can I mix different floor types in my home?
Absolutely. Many Orlando homeowners successfully combine tile in wet areas like kitchens and bathrooms with hardwood or carpet in living spaces and bedrooms. The key is creating visual continuity through complementary colors and transitions that feel intentional.
What decor trends are popular in Orlando right now?
Natural materials, warm neutral color palettes, and sustainable design choices dominate current Orlando decorating trends. Homeowners are gravitating toward organic textures, indoor plants, and pieces that blend comfort with contemporary style.
How do I choose the right rug for my flooring type?
Consider both aesthetics and function when selecting rugs. For tile floors, plush rugs add warmth and comfort. Hardwood floors pair well with flat-weave or low-pile rugs that protect the surface while adding visual interest. Always measure your space carefully to ensure proper sizing.
